Wind and snowfall warnings up for B.C.

Wind and snowfall warnings have been posted for a large section of B.C.

Environment Canada has issued snowfall warnings for parts of the southern Interior and northern and central B.C., with accumulations of up to 25 centimetres expected in some areas by Tuesday.

Wind warnings have been issued for Vancouver Island, the Fraser Valley, Howe Sound, Metro Vancouver, the Sunshine Coast and the Southern Gulf Islands.

The weather agency says a rapidly deepening area of low pressure will create gusty winds on Tuesday, reaching 90 kilometres per hour in some areas, including the Fraser Valley and Victoria.

It says the strong southeasterly winds are coming in advance of a cold front and will ease by Tuesday afternoon.

Several special weather statements have also been posted warning of a brief period of heavy snow that could make driving dangerous.
